Transaction e59fed732cf113eaef92028ad9f4c6ae8f005f8f5f9ee7c4ab6b1385361632d2
3 Input
2 Outputs
- e59fed732cf113eaef92028ad9f4c6ae8f005f8f5f9ee7c4ab6b1385361632d2:0
- e59fed732cf113eaef92028ad9f4c6ae8f005f8f5f9ee7c4ab6b1385361632d2:1
value 19237817
address 3328bV2nWVoAoQrMogGYjketA9HX6eJ7bT
value 19262183
address 3BMEXzhBA6wgqYNyNfVaRGVFsUPWaVHaDH